Anabelle Cora Wilson died peacefully in her home surrounded by family on May 10, 2017.

Anabelle was born on December 11, 2010, in beautiful Bend, Oregon, the daughter of Ronn and Alexandra Wilson. She suffered from a rare terminal disease called Metachromatic Leukodystrophy (MLD).

Anabelle’s life and light spread far further than she ever could have reached. She is the inspiration for the Anabelle’s Angel Glow Run that raises money for kids with special needs in Central Oregon through Sparrow Clubs and kids with MLD worldwide through the MLD Foundation. She is also the namesake of the scholarship fund at Treehouse Therapies, that helps kids get the therapies they need regardless of their ability to pay.

Anabelle attended Silver Rail Elementary where she got to enjoy kindergarten and inspire a community into inclusion. She was surrounded by precious friends every day that were the light of her life.
